Output 582171732a389096138f2405bbf197c59370e64e548ab8ebd170117e26423179:0

value
6707704
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6da26ac58958ef3465e76e87c61d7391c44dc06 OP_EQUALVERIFY OP_CHECKSIG
address
1HfqKKGiyECh8rDqTW9P55Erfs3PoPRy9T
transaction
582171732a389096138f2405bbf197c59370e64e548ab8ebd170117e26423179
spent
true